    I just got myself a Pixel 7 Pro one week ago. So far the experience is really-really good. I just noticed few bugs that some might be interested to hear before buying:
    - There is a slight animation stutter/lag when unlocking with fingerprints from the not awaken display, when your AOD turns on and you unlock device from this state. I found a workaround for that. In developer settings there is an option 'Animator duration scale' if you set it to 0.5x lag is gone.
    - There are sometimes inconsistency with swiping motion, when scrolling feeds for example, same finger swipe will sometimes give either very fast scroll or will scroll few inches. Doesn't happen very often, but when it does it's kinda annoying. Tried changing different settings, results are the same. Multiple topics on different forums confirm that this problem is widespread. No workaround still. Hope next update will fix it.
    - Inconsistency with back gestures left and right. When trying to go back you have to swipe all the way from the edge, like almost touching metal. If you go all the way from the edge, it works consistently. But if you try to swipe back few mm away from the edge it will sometimes work, sometimes it will just scroll your app horizontally or will do any default swiping action your current app is set to. Came from OnePlus 7 Pro with same curved display and had no similar problems with that. I guess there is a need to increase range of swiping detection
    Battery charging is slow compared to other flagships. It is good for a battery in a long term tho. Could be better if charging speeds would be on Iphone level at least.
    Othen than that great phone, very fast, outstanding camera, video is doing good too, not Iphone levels good, but gets the job done.
